Foreclosure Defense

If you have been served with a foreclosure summons and complaint on your residence, Mr. Marks can strategize a legal defense to buy you time to stay in your home.

The foreclosure defense, which first involves the filing of a Verified Answer to the foreclosure complaint, can allow you a great deal of flexibility and time to pursue a range of further options. These options may include:

  1. A loan modification on your existing mortgage;
  2. A forbearance agreement, which adds missed mortgage payments onto the end of your loan;
  3. A short sale, if you decide to sell the house;
  4. A Chapter 7 or Chapter 13 bankruptcy filing (I can refer you to a reputable attorney for this);
  5. Technical defenses based on the discovery of defects in your loan, such as statute of limitations, breach of contract, or improper endorsements of assignments, which can sometimes void the entire mortgage.

Then once your retainer is paid and the necessary documents hae been provided, the attorney will file the legal answer to the foreclosure complaint and will attend (with you) the Preliminary Conference (also called a Settlement Conference), a good-faith negotiation between you and your lender.

If that negotiation fails, or we have discovered certain irregularities with your mortgage, we can fight out your case in court.
